Design

Crosstrek receives a new front fascia, headlights and grille, as well as new 17-inch dark grey alloy wheels on gas models. Hybrid variants get the same frontend changes, but receive a grille with gloss black finish. The cabin gets a bit of bedazzling with a redesigned steering wheel that features eye-catching orange contrast stitching on 2.0i Premium and above trims. Also, new silver and gloss black trim has been added on the dashboard of 2.0i Limited and Hybrid Touring models.

Safety

Subaru STARLINK Connected Services has been added to the lineup and two packages with trial periods are offered: Safety Plus and Safety Plus & Security Plus. These packages, which are optional on Premium and Limited trims, enhance the capabilities of Subaru’s STARLINK infotainment unit. Connected Services package content is as follows:

STARLINK Safety Plus

  • SOS Emergency Assistance
  • Automatic Collision Notification
  • Enhanced Roadside Assistance
  • Maintenance Notifications
  • Monthly Vehicle Health Report
  • Diagnostic Alerts

STARLINK Safety Plus & Security Plus
All of the features above with the addition of:

  • Vehicle Security Alarm Notification
  • Stolen Vehicle Recovery Service
  • Remote Horn and Lights
  • Remote Lock/Unlock
  • Remote Vehicle Locator

Also this year, new Blind Spot Detection and Rear Cross Traffic Alert technologies have been added as standard equipment on Limited and Hybrid Touring models. Lane Change Assist has also been added as a new option.

Other Updates

  • Every 2016 Subaru Crosstrek adds new nighttime LED illumination under the radio on the center console.
  • Crosstrek 2.0i Limited trims receive the following features as standard for the new model year: a continuously variable transmission (CVT) and leather-covered seats, shift handle and steering wheel.
  • The Keyless Access with Push Button start feature, which is standard on all hybrids and optional on the Limited, now includes convenient Pin Code Access.
  • Navigation and SiriusXM NavWeather and NavTraffic services (with subscription) are added to Crosstrek Hybrid Touring models.
